Editorial Reviews
Album Description
Imani Winds is the first every classically based woodwind quintet made up of musicians of African-American and Latino heritage. Their music directly reflects the unique combination of this cultural background and the rich tradition of Westeren classical music. The debut album of Imani Winds begins with their signature piece written by the founder and fluist, Valerie Coleman, "Umoja", which means unity in Swahilli, and continues to take the listenter on an exciting journey through a new take on the standard quintet repertoire. Highlights of the album include Paquito D'Rivera's "Wapango", with guest artist, Rolando Morales-Matos on bongos; the standards by Villa-Lobos and Francaix; new arrangements of pieces by the jazz French Hornist John Clark and the king of the tango, Astor Piazolla; and finally arrangements of traditional Black Spirituals, that truly take the listener back to the roots of African-American people. Imani Winds' Umoja offers a classical and contem! porary music experience like no other.

Terrific throwback to MJQ's early sound..........2003-12-26
I hope if Mr. Dorsey reads this, he accepts that when I compare the work of his group on this CD to the 1950's sound of the Modern Jazz Quartet, I am paying a high compliment. His bass-playing and song-writing, Bryan Carrott's vibraphone, the piano of Carlton Holmes, and the drumming by Vincent Ector are all superb. I had never heard of Dorsey or any of the other members when I purchased this because it looked interesting and the price was a bargain. I was a bit hesitant because Dorsey titled four of the nine tracks with religious terms, and I was worried I might be subjected to the kind of spiritual dissonance John Coltrane cultivated in parts of his famous "A Love Supreme." (While that album is beloved by many, it is the least favorite of my own dozen Coltrane discs.) However, on Dorsey's disc, "Baptism" and "Thessalonians" and "Song of Songs" and "Until the End of Time" are lovely, swinging bop tunes. No vocals, no chants, just great small-group jazz that is real jazz, not the bland stuff called "smooth" in recent years. Don't get me wrong...this unit is not cloning the MJQ, even though the same four instruments are present. Dorsey is the leader, so bass is more prominent than it was in MJQ; Mr. Carrott, good as he is on vibes, is not the immortal Milt Jackson, so Holmes' piano is more prominent. But if you are a fan of MJQ, you can't help but like this album too. It's 54 minutes of happiness, and I am delighted to have accidentally stumbled across it. Dorsey's compositions are consistently interesting, too. Jazz lovers, grab this if you can find it. Although it was recorded in 1999, it seems to be scarce, since it is not a major label product. It sure deserves wide exposure.

Overlooked Free Jazz Recording.......2007-01-15
This album came with recommendations, high recommendations from a list of free jazz classics by Thurston Moore of Sonic Youth. I've heard several recordings by Frank Wright, an essential free jazz artist and the mid point between John Coltrane, and Charles Gayle and David S. Ware and this is my favorite out of all of them. That is because the line up provides (relatively) more structure. Frank Wright's playing is extremely free but stays closer to the realm of free jazz, rather than free improv. with the back up of Art Taylor who played mostly on classic hard bop recordings as well as Noah Howard whose style is closer to post bop. With them and pianist Bobby Few, Uhuru Na Umoja, an album(albeit extremely short)of creative free jazz work outs is grounded in certain melodic aspects which enhance it. This is probably the place to start with Frank Wright and now as well since this is a limited edition cd.

Miles Away... Wayne in Heavy -- by Scott Yanow, AMG.......2004-11-27
The repertoire of the mid-1960s Miles Davis Quintet is adapted and explored on this excellent CD by pianist Eric Gould, bassist Leon Lee Dorsey and drummer Greg Bandy. Despite the absence of trumpet and tenor, the 11 songs on the project work quite well in this format. The repertoire includes a few standards ("Nefertiti,' "E.S.P.," "Seven Steps To Heaven" and "Nardis") and some songs not often recorded since the `60s. Gould's piano style, though influenced a little by Herbie Hancock, is pretty original and his close interplay with his sidemen results in an appealing and fairly distinctive group sound. Each of these performances works quite well as Gould and his trio pay a little tribute to the past but also come up with consistently fresh statements. Recommended. - Scott Yanow

THE ROOTS AND THE PRESSURE.......2004-08-27
UMOJA/20th CENTURY DEBwise: Collecting two long-lost late 70s dubwise LPs from Dennis Brown and Prince Jammy, Blood & Fire's latest reissue offers just about everything you would expect from such a momentous meeting of minds: up-front drum and bass, spectral horn lines, and heavy showers of reverb. Dennis Brown's voice is almost completely excised, but with session superstars such as Sly and Robbie (drums and bass), Bingi Bunny, Chinna Smith (both guitar), Winston Wright (keyboards) and studio-dweller Sticky Thompson (percussion) working the rhythms, vocals aren't even a consideration. Heavy, heavy roots pressure throughout; this is a great addition to the Blood & Fire catalogue. The label also re-released Brown's JOSEPH'S COAT OF MANY COLOURS LP (as PROMISED LAND - with a nice haul of bonus tracks) in 2002.

"On the Real" by Frank Rubolino, Cadence Magazine.......2004-11-27
Bouncing jazz with a happy lilt is in the offing from Gould on "On the Real." He and his groups of varying sizes play seven of his compositions and two Jazz classics with and enthusiastic attitude that shines through on all selections. Gould leads from the piano chair, alternating bassists and drummers behind the soloing and theme statements of the front line of English on reeds and Burks on trumpet. Their sound is cheery and effervescent, and they develop the pieces into fine improvising vehicles. Although no recording date is given, I gather it is a rather recent date. Gould acknowledges that his compositions, however, were written in the late 1970's and 1980's, so he is no stranger to the music world although this is his first recording.
The closing "Dolphin Dance" is present as a piano trio and best shows the playing talent of Gould. His touch is light, yet his style is aggressive enough to give the tune a lot of punch. Elsewhere, he comes across very much as a team play, giving English and Burks frequent and ample soloing opportunities. Both men fit into the genial playing style dictated by Gould's writing. Witness their horns laughing on the album's opener as an indicator of this happy style of playing. Ransom and King share almost all the drumming chores. They both appear on "Stolen Legacy," a rhythm-based tune with an African influence that also features poetry dealing with that continent written and recited by Okantah.
Gould's presentation is solid and the music has much spunk to go along with its uplifting spirit. His efforts equate with a lighthearted but no light recording that has a lot of zip to it. - Frank Rubolino, Cadence

"Who Sez?" by Scott Yanow, All Music Guide to Jazz.......2004-11-27
Pianist Eric Gould alternates three of his originals with jazz standards from John Coltrane, Cedar Walton, Joe Henderson, Wayne Shorter, and Horace Silver on the modern straight-ahead jazz set Who Sez?. Gould plays quite well (with touches of early Herbie Hancock, Keith Jarrett, and McCoy Tyner in his ideas), while Talib Kibwe on alto and soprano sometimes comes close to overshadowing the leader. Trumpeter Pharez Whitted has his spots too, but the focus is primarily on Gould and Kibwe. The modal music, much of it based in the 1960s, is well served by these talented musicians, and although the playing is not flawless (plenty of chances are taken), it is never dull. The musicians all show strong potential for the future. - Scott Yanow
